Kiernan Bell is the Bermuda Office Managing Partner and has overall responsibility for managing the operations of Appleby’s Bermuda office.
Kiernan is also Bermuda Practice Group Head for the Litigation & Insolvency department. She specialises in complex commercial disputes, and has practice experience in shareholder disputes, derivative actions, professional negligence, M&A, contentious insolvency, international arbitration, insurance and reinsurance disputes.
Kiernan has experience working with multi-jurisdictional teams of lawyers on complex cases and deals. She has prepared cases for hearing at every level, including before the Judicial Committee of the Privy Council, Bermuda’s highest appellate court. Kiernan joined Appleby in 1994, became a partner in 2002 and was elected Bermuda Managing Partner in 2012.
Clients interviewed by Global Chambers and Partners describe Kiernan as “Dynamic, quick and aggressive”.
She is the immediate past President of the Bermuda Bar Council which is the governing body of the Bermuda Bar Association. Kiernan was an elected member of the Bermuda Bar Council from 2000 and the President in 2009 to 2011. She is the former Chair of the Continuing Legal Education Committee of the Bar. Kiernan is a member of the International Bar Association and the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ators.
